Christ the King Church is located on the way to Coaker's Walk. This Gothic style church is built with black stones in the shape of a cross.

A small church with wooden pews, stained glass windows and Stone memorials was constructed by American Madurai Missionaries in 1895 AD
It is also known as Union Church and CSI Church.

There is an antique musical organ on one side of the altar. The alter is decorated with curtains and flowers and the cross.
